Как узнать какой порт использует SQL Server

Чтобы узнать, какой порт использует SQL Server, вы можете воспользоваться утилитой sqlcmd или osql для подключения к серверу и использования следующего скрипта:


    SELECT local_net_address, local_tcp_port
    FROM sys.dm_exec_connections
    WHERE local_net_address IS NOT NULL
    

Этот скрипт позволит вам получить IP-адрес сервера и используемый им порт TCP.

Детальный ответ

Как узнать, какой порт использует SQL Server?

SQL Server - это одна из самых популярных систем управления базами данных (СУБД) в мире, используемая для хранения и обработки данных. Если вы хотите подключиться к SQL Server из внешнего приложения или сети, вам понадобится знать, какой порт использует SQL Server для коммуникации.

Существует несколько способов узнать порт, используемый SQL Server. Давайте рассмотрим некоторые из них.

1. Использование SQL Server Configuration Manager

SQL Server Configuration Manager - это инструмент, предоставляемый Microsoft для настройки и управления конфигурацией SQL Server. Вы можете использовать этот инструмент для определения текущего порта, используемого SQL Server.

Чтобы узнать порт через SQL Server Configuration Manager, выполните следующие шаги:

  1. Откройте SQL Server Configuration Manager на сервере SQL.
  2. Разверните ветку "SQL Server Network Configuration".
  3. Выберите ваш экземпляр SQL Server.
  4. На панели справа выберите вкладку "TCP/IP".
  5. В окне "IP Addresses" найдите раздел "IPAll".
  6. В поле "TCP Dynamic Ports" будут указаны порты, используемые SQL Server.

Примечание: Если поле "TCP Dynamic Ports" пустое, это означает, что SQL Server использует статический порт, указанный в поле "TCP Port".

2. Использование командной строки

Если у вас нет доступа к SQL Server Configuration Manager, вы можете воспользоваться командной строкой для получения информации о порте.

Откройте командную строку и выполните следующую команду:

sqlcmd -S <server_name>

Здесь "<server_name>" - это имя вашего сервера SQL.

После выполнения команды вы увидите список свойств сервера SQL, включая порт, который он использует.

3. Использование SQL скрипта

Вы также можете использовать SQL скрипт для получения информации о порте, используемом SQL Server.

Вот пример SQL скрипта, который вы можете выполнить в SQL Server Management Studio:

SELECT local_net_address, local_tcp_port
FROM sys.dm_exec_connections
WHERE local_net_address IS NOT NULL
AND local_tcp_port IS NOT NULL;

После выполнения скрипта вы увидите результат с IP-адресом и портом, используемым SQL Server.

Заключение

В этой статье мы рассмотрели несколько способов узнать, какой порт использует SQL Server. Вы можете использовать SQL Server Configuration Manager, командную строку или SQL скрипт для получения этой информации. Узнав порт, вы сможете подключаться к SQL Server из внешних приложений и сетей.

Видео по теме

Как найти и запустить экземпляр SQL Server

2.7 Изменение порта SQL Server и добавление правила в брандмауэр Windows

Find port on which SQL Server is running on WINDOWS 11 | MS SQL SERVER

Похожие статьи:

🗑️ Как удалить запрос SQL и избавиться от ненужной информации в базе данных

Как удалить файлы журнала SQL: подробное руководство

Как узнать какой порт использует SQL Server